๐ŸŒ Overview

The AEA Singapore ๐Ÿ‡ธ๐Ÿ‡ฌ Malaysia ๐Ÿ‡ฒ๐Ÿ‡พ Thailand ๐Ÿ‡น๐Ÿ‡ญ Culinary Arts Program provides an in-depth exploration of Southeast Asiaโ€™s diverse food traditions. Students learn through hands-on cooking classes, bustling market visits, and cultural excursions across three countries, from Singaporean street food to Thai island cuisine.
